Abstract
A tissue-fastening device with counter gripping resilient anchors folded within a needle is delivered through bulging tissue into the intervertebral disc. The bulge is then compressed, a plunger is held stationary behind the fastener while the needle is withdrawn. As the restriction of the needle is removed, the resilient anchors open, counter fastening the annular tissues across the central disc by both ends of the tissue fastener. Since the anchors open within the compressed bulge, the previously bulging annulus is mechanically anchored and fastened down by the tissue fastener, free from impinging the adjacent nerve. A toggle and a disc restraining device are also proposed to compress bulging discs. To decompress bulging discs, a disc drain tube containing inlet and outlet openings, with pressure-regulating capabilities, drains nucleus pulposus from a swollen intervertebral disc to alleviate low back pain.
